Job Description

Director, Analytical Sciences & R&D

Kelly® Science & Clinical is seeking a Director, Analytical Sciences & R&D for a direct-hire position at a cutting-edge client in Irvine, CA . If you’re passionate about bringing the latest scientific discoveries to life and are ready to take the next step in your career, trust The Experts at Hiring Experts.

Salary: $150,000.00 to $175,000.00

Schedule: Full Time Onsite

Overview

This client is an industry-leading company that’s leading the way in pharmaceutical research and development. In this role, you will manage the analytical sciences group and the method development sub-group to support the development and troubleshooting of methods for all types of finished dosage forms. You will also address analytical issues, lead investigations, and ensure compliance with regulatory standards.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age the analytical sciences and method development teams.
  • Develop and troubleshoot methods for various finished dosage forms.
  • Address analytical issues in FDA deficiency letters and draft responses.
  • Write and review method validation and development protocols and reports.
  • Conduct investigations into analytical testing result failures.
  • Ensure compliance with cGMP regulations and SOPs.
  • Collaborate with other departments to support analytical work.
  • Review quality and technical activities for SOP/GMP compliance.
  • Perform or assist with equipment calibrations and qualifications.
  • Train and guide chemists in method development.
  • Perform other related duties as required.

Qualifications:

  • MS or Ph.D. in organic chemistry, analytical chemistry, pharmaceutical sciences, or a related field.
  • 10+ years of experience in pharmaceutical ANDA & NDA development/analytical/CDMO labs.
  • Small Molecule experience required.
  • 8+ years of experience with analytical instrumentation (HPLC, GC, MS, ICP, etc.).
  • Proven leadership and people management experience in an analytical group.
  • Experience in FDA-regulated environments and compliance with State and Federal regulations.
  • Extensive experience in HPLC method development and validation.
  • Proficiency in MS Office and project management tools.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to lead, organize, prioritize, and manage multiple tasks effectively.
  • Strong attention to detail and a collaborative team mindset.
